求用I/O实现对NAND flash的读写代码谁有啊,

硬件/嵌入开发 > 嵌入开发(WinCE) [问题点数:100分,结帖人CSDN]
等级
本版专家分:0
结帖率 100%
等级
本版专家分:0
blue_coco

等级:

最小 flash I/O单元 与 NAND flash 子页

Minimum flash IO unit UBI uses an abstract model of flash. In short, from UBI's point of view the flash (or MTD device) consists of eraseblocks, which may be good or bad. Each good eraseblock may b

nand flash 读写测试

参考链接:https://www.cnblogs.com/pengdonglin137/p/3468953.html 测试程序: #include <stdio.h> #include <string.h> #include <sys/types.h> #include <sys/stat.h>...fc...

nand flash读写操作

使用nand flash之前需要其进行必要的配置,主要有这几件事要做: 1.根据date sheet在NFCONF寄存器中设置读、写的时间参数(TACLS、TWRPH0、TWRPH1) 2.在NFCONT控制寄存器中使能nand flash控制器并片选(如需...

NAND FLASH读写操作(硬件原理图分析)

上面是我使用NAND FLASH的硬件原理图,面对这些引脚,很难明白他们是什么含义,下面直接引用韦东山老师的课程中的提问: NAND FLASH是一个存储芯片 那么: 这样的操作很合理"读地址A的数据,把数据B写到地址A" ...

嵌入式linux之Nor/Nand FLASH读写

所谓Flash,是内存(Memory)的一种,但兼有RAM和ROM 的优点,是一种可在系统(In-System)进行电擦写,掉电后信息不丢失的存储器,同时它的高集成度和低成本使它成为市场主流。  Flash 芯片是由内部成千上万个存储...

SD nand flash 简单的读写速度测试

SD nand flash 简单的读写速度测试背景和常见SD卡比较测试环境介绍 背景 SD nand flash 可以看作是兼容了SD协议的nand flash: SD nand flash = SD卡控制器 + nand flash 以上结构可以看出,SD要火拼的是SD卡(至于...

NAND FLASH读写速度计算方法详解

Nand Flash读写速度的计算方法 在下面的部分,我们以Micron的Nand Flash芯片为例,看一下Nand Flash的访问速度(Write / Read)是如何计算的?我们可以利用Datasheet提供的Read / Program / Erase操作时序图进行...

NAND Flash硬件读写原理

1.nand接口 s3c2440板的Nand Flash模块由两部分组成:Nand Flash控制器(集成在s3c2440)和Nand Flash存储芯片(K9F1208U0B)两大部分组成。当要访问Nand Flash中的数据时,必须通过Nand Flash控制器发送命令序列才能完成...

FPGA 控制 nand flash读写

最近 项目上FPGA 去操作nand_flash.终于实现 了。其实主要把 NAND_FLASH接口时序搞定,就没有问题。

NandFlash读写过程

一、结构分析 ...S3C2410处理器集成了8位NandFlash控制器。目前市场上常见的8位NandFlash有三星公司的k9f1208、k9f1g08、k9f2g08等。k9f1208、k9f1g08、k9f2g08的数据页大小分别为512Byte、2kByte、2kByte

应用层读写nandflash示例

为了不影响其他文件,最好再多分出一个分区,专门用于flash操作 include sys/ioctl.h include stdio.h include mtd/mtd-user.h include sys/types.h include sys/stat.h include fcntl.h include unistd.h include...

nandflash读写源码,代码清晰

了解nandflash的参考//----------------------------------------#define NAND_CMD_READ_A 0x00 #define NAND_CMD_READ_B 0x01#define NAND_CMD_READ_C 0x50#define NAND_CMD_SIGNATURE 

Nand flash读写范围的问题

很多时候对nand的操作都是通过主控的nand控制器直接完成,或者更多时候是通过MTD标准操作接口完成读写擦的过程,然而有些细节问题有必要在这里讨论一下,我分为以下几点进行说明: flash读写范围的问题" title=...

NAND Flash 读写操作

Fisrt part : ...NAND flash使用复杂的I/O口来穿行地存取数据。8个引脚用来传送控制、地址和数据信息。NAND的读和写单位为512Byte的页,擦写单位为32页的块。 ● NOR的读速度比NAND稍快一些。  

STM32F103的FSMC读写NANDFlash的学习

1. STM32的FSMC接口可以控制外部的NANDFlash,因此学习下,先看下硬件电路,地址线是A16.A17,数据线D0-D7,那么映射的地址空间是多少?D0是数据/地址线,两个用途。 2. 引脚图,现在关心的是,这个NAND的地址映射...

NANDFlash原理

NAND Flash作为一种比较实用的固态硬盘存储介质,有自己的一些物理特性,需要有基本的管理技术才能使用设计者来说,挑战主要在下面几点: 1.需要先擦除才能写入。 2.损耗机制,有耐久度限制。 3.读写时候造成...

对NandFlash编程实现代码进行分析

整个程序段分解为四个部分来分析,初始化NandFlash,读取NandFlash的ID号,NandFlash块擦洗,NandFlash的页数据读写; 在对代码进行分析之前需要把代码中的相应常量定义先列出来: #define EnNandFlash() ...

NAND FLASH读写原理

S3C2410处理器集成了8位Nand Flash控制器。目前市场上常见的8位NandFlash有三星公司的k9f1208、k9f1g08、k9f2g08等。k9f1208、k9f1g08、k9f2g08的数据页大小分别为512Byte、2kByte、2kByte。它们在寻址方式上有一定...

2017年6月问题记录与总结——ZYNQ_7000(PL35X)模块(NOR/SRAM/NAND FLASH 控制器)读取NAND FLASH ID

1.NAND FLASH1.flash型号MT29F4G082.FLASH基本信息位宽:8位容量大小:4Gb = 512MBBLOCK大小:128K +4kpage大小:2K + 64bytesblock数量:4096(2*2048)每个block的pages数量:128K/2K = 643.FLASH的物理组织这里...

关于NAND Flash调试的一点总结

很久没接触过 nandflash 驱动,最近工作又摸了,于是顺便整理总结一下。nandflash 在我看来算是比较落后的存储设备,所以文章里没有太多细节的东西,更多的是一些开发思路和经验,希望能帮助到有需要的人。 一、了解...

51单片机控制K9K8G08U0C NAND Flash读写程序

网上看到这个源代码,虽然感觉51用到nandflash的情况不多,但是可以借鉴理解nandflash读写流程 #include #include #include /********************************************/ sbit NF_CLE=P0^3; //命令锁存...

nand flash 读写(基本操作)

 希望通过这篇文章记录一下自己在调试NAND flash的经验。希望大家有用。  上个月搞了一块开发板QT210。说实话没有找到很多的datasheet就开始搞了。最早还是从boot说起,说到这这里不得不提到boot中打印的错误...

NAND FLASH 读写ECC校验(BCH)

ECC的全称是Error Checking and Correction,是一种用于Nand的差错检测和修正算法。如果操作时序和电路稳定性不存在问题的话,NAND ...常采用BCH算法纠正4bit或是8bit的错误码修正,其实现代码在内核3.0以上或是ub...

NAND Flash操作技术详解

2014-06-22 01:12:57 NAND Flash是构成固态存储...控制器对NAND Flash进行操作时需要通过命令交互的方式对NAND Flash进行操作。下面对NAND Flash的操作进行解析可以发现在研发FTL的时候可以充分发掘NAND Flash提供...

nandflash读写

摘要 以三星公司K9F2808UOB为例,设计了NAND Flash与S3C2410的接口电路,介绍了NAND Flash在ARM嵌入式系统中的设计与实现方法,并在UBoot上进行了验证。所设计的驱动易于移植,可简化嵌入式系统开发。  

详述NOR FlashNAND Flash区别

在介绍NOR FlashNAND Flash之前,首先介绍一下NOR FlashNAND Flash的产生历史。 1、EPROM Intel很早就发明了EPROM,这是一种可以紫外线擦除的存储器。相较于ROM,它的内容可以更新而且可以保持10~20年,...

uboot环境下nandflash读写

大家好: 请问在uboot环境下,如何对nandflash进行读写操作?主要是实现对某个地址进行设置标识?谢谢!

NAND Flash(spi nand flashnand flash)和emmc以及ufs通过uboot烧写固件的一些差异

目录 ...1.2NAND Flash/SPI-Nand Flash烧写方法 2.eMMC的u-boot烧写方法 3.UFS u-boot烧写方法 1.Flash的u-boot烧写方法 1.1SPI-Nor Flash烧写方法 uboot# mw.b 0x420000000 0xff 0x100000...

相关热词 c# 点击事件 自动点击 c# 图片透明背景 c# 模拟按键 c# 线程同步方式 c# 集合改变 1 c# c# 后进先出 集合 c#执行私有方法 c#排序从大到小 c#访问修饰符总结